• Asthma affects the lower airways,
causing inflammation and constriction
(McDowell et al., 2023).
• Bronchoconstriction limits airflow,
leading to difficulty breathing (Levy et
al., 2024).
• Excess mucus worsens symptoms like
wheezing and coughing (Shah et al.,
